Sony PRS-T1: SD card affects battery life?
Hello.
It makes sense that the added card will require more power, and that further power will be spent by the PDU indexing a large set of files on the card. I just bought a T1 to replace my broken 650 (who knew dropping repeatedly is bad?), and am wondering if I should buy a card or not. I'd like to have the added capacity, but not if the battery life tanks. For those of you with T1s and SD cards - have you noticed a large difference in battery performance? thanks, Andrew |

I've had an SD card installed in my T1 since even before I booted it up for the first time, so I couldn't tell you if there was any performance difference.
But as for how long my T1's battery lasts, it generally takes at least 4 days of continuous usage for the icon to drop by even 1 bar. I regularly spend around 3 hours on or waiting for public transit most days and read during most of that time, plus additional reading at breaks and between classes and sometimes in the evening, and I turn the wireless on and off so I can check stuff on the internet from time to time. Lately I've been finishing roughly 1 book per day (and additional shorts/novellas), and much of what I've been reading is between 150-250 pages. I only bother to recharge when the battery meter has dropped to half, which is roughly every other week for me. Hope this helps. |

If you have 2000 and more books I think it is better to turn off display of covers in book library and in collections. This way reader is more responsive and saves battery.
I use Calibre to manage my book collection. Calibre version 0.8.55 fixed a bug that was corrupting database of books on SD card. When I change from Kobo Touch to PRS-T1 i run Calibre welcome wizard telling it I'm using PRS-T. Calibre. When I plug connect PRS-T1 Calibre displays message that it detects the Sony reader but does not respond correctly unless I run the wizard changing settings. |
